阅读量:5
利用Tomcat日志进行安全审计是一个重要的过程,可以帮助识别和防范潜在的安全威胁。以下是一些关键步骤和方法:
日志文件位置和配置
- 日志文件位置:Tomcat日志文件通常位于
CATALINA_HOME/logs目录下,主要日志文件为catalina.out,此外还有每日生成的日志文件。 - 日志配置:在
server.xml中配置AccessLogValve以记录访问日志。可以通过修改directory、prefix、suffix和pattern等属性来定制日志格式和存储位置。
日志分析基本方法
- 查看和分析日志:使用文本编辑器(如
vi、nano或less)打开日志文件,分析其中的错误信息、异常堆栈跟踪、访问日志等。 - 使用命令行工具:例如,使用
grep过滤特定关键字,awk进行复杂文本处理,tail -f实时查看日志输出。
安全审计特定配置
- 启用详细访问日志:在
server.xml中配置AccessLogValve,记录客户端IP地址、请求URL、响应状态码等信息。 - 日志轮转和清理:配置日志轮转策略,避免单个日志文件过大,同时定期清理旧的日志文件以节省存储空间。
日志分析工具的使用
- ELK Stack:使用Elasticsearch、Logstash和Kibana进行日志收集、处理和可视化。
- Graylog:一个功能强大的开源日志管理平台,可以集中存储、搜索和分析日志数据。
- Flume:用于实时日志采集、聚合和传输的系统,适用于大规模日志处理。
结合Linux安全审计
- Linux auditd服务:与Tomcat日志结合使用,记录系统级的安全事件,如文件访问、权限变更等,提供更全面的安全审计。
通过上述方法,可以有效地利用Tomcat日志进行安全审计,及时发现和响应潜在的安全威胁。
以上就是关于“如何利用Tomcat日志进行安全审计”的相关介绍,筋斗云是国内较早的云主机应用的服务商,拥有10余年行业经验,提供丰富的云服务器、租用服务器等相关产品服务。云服务器资源弹性伸缩,主机vCPU、内存性能强悍、超高I/O速度、故障秒级恢复;电子化备案,提交快速,专业团队7×24小时服务支持!
简单好用、高性价比云服务器租用链接:https://www.jindouyun.cn/product/cvm